CMP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2015 in Review

268 of the 3,812 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Compass Minerals (CMP) for Q4 2015, worth a combined $2.46B — down 1.2% from $2.49B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 37 funds closed out of CMP and 34 opened new positions — a net loss of 3 holders — while 86 trimmed existing stakes and 110 added.

The largest buyer was Perkins Investment Management, adding an estimated $71.6M. The largest seller was Neuberger Berman Group, cutting an estimated $33.6M.
